Mark Hominick vs Yves Edwards: Matchup Breakdown
Mark Hominick is 3-4 in the Featherweight division with a 42.9% win rate. Yves Edwards is 10-10 at Lightweight, winning 50% of the time. Both are listed as retired.
They have met 1 time. Mark Hominick leads the series 1-0. Their most recent meeting was UFC 58: USA vs Canada on Mar 4, 2006, won by Mark Hominick by Submission in round 2.
Mark Hominick holds the higher ELO rating, 932 to 867. Career peaks are 1,072 for Mark Hominick and 1,084 for Yves Edwards. Mark Hominick has 1 KO/TKO and 1 submission win from 3 victories, a 66.7% finish rate. Yves Edwards has 5 KO/TKO and 2 submission wins, finishing 70% of the time.
Mark Hominick stands 5' 8" with a reach of 68" and fights orthodox. Yves Edwards is 5' 9" with a reach of 73", southpaw. That is a 5-inch reach advantage for Yves Edwards. Mark Hominick is 44, Yves Edwards is 49.
Across the bouts with round-by-round data recorded, Mark Hominick has landed 294 significant strikes at 42.6% accuracy with 2 takedowns and 6:00 of control time. Yves Edwards has landed 561 at 42.8% with 6 takedowns and 39:44 of control.
Mark Hominick has 1 title fight (0 won) against 0 (0 won) for Yves Edwards. They have no opponents in common.
